Drawing on years of experience as professional photographers and lecturers, Galer and Andrews offer photographers and designers a self-study guide to using the digital darkroom rather than the traditional darkroom for creative photographic illustration. Written for beginner to intermediate Photoshop users, the text uses a structured learning approach, combining explanations with practical, step-by-step applications of the skills. The first half of the text features an extensive foundation module covering all the basics of the image-editing process from capture to print, followed by modules teaching advanced skills, such as layers and channels, selections, filters, and layer blends. The second half contains 29 retouching, composite, and special effects projects enabling users to apply the skills learned in the previous modules. Through a companion website, users can access the images for the projects, 10-plus hours of movie tutorials, online chapters, and other resources.
